Chelsea Nike Contract 15 Year Deal

Chelsea has announced a new 15-year £900 million sponsorship with Nike to start during the 2017-2018 season, thus ending their current deal with adidas. This will be the largest kit partnership in the history of English football clubs, as the sponsorship will come in at roughly £60 million per season (still behind the yearly total of Manchester United’s 10-year £75 million contract with adidas).

Chelsea director Marina Granovskaia had this to say about the new partnership between the Blues and the Swoosh: “This is an incredibly exciting and important deal for the club. Like Chelsea, Nike is known around the world for its excellence and innovation and we look forward to working together in what is sure to be a successful partnership. We believe Nike will be able to support our growth into new markets as well as helping us maintain our place among the world’s elite football clubs.”

Trevor Edwards, President of Nike Brand also chimed in: “Chelsea is a world-class club with a rich tradition and passionate fans across the globe. The partnership with Chelsea reinforces our leadership position in football. We are excited to help grow the club’s global reach, serving players and supporters with Nike innovation and design.”
